GitBucket GitBucket GitBucket
Toggle navigation
  • Pull requests
  • Issues
  • Snippets
  • Sign in
  • Files
  • Branches 53
  • Releases
  • Issues 10
  • Pull requests
  • Labels
  • Priorities
  • Milestones
  • Wiki
Fork: 1
nitta-lab / AlgebraicDataflowArchitectureModel
Save Cancel

algebra.ExpressionにVisitor Patternを適用しました. #146

Merged c-okada merged 8 commits into nitta-lab:ast-core from nitta-lab:apply-visitor-pattern 2 days ago
  • Conversation 0
  • Commits 8
  • Files Changed 9
2026-03-02
df5595c
Browse files »
@shohei-yamagiwa
Replace all toImplementations() in Expression with the new visitor pattern implementation
shohei-yamagiwa committed 5 days ago
b8be922
Browse files »
@shohei-yamagiwa
Merge branch 'ast-core' of http://nitta-lab-www.is.konan-u.ac.jp/gitbucket/git/nitta-lab/AlgebraicDataflowArchitectureModel into apply-visitor-pattern
shohei-yamagiwa committed 5 days ago
2026-02-26
76a17ad
Browse files »
@shohei-yamagiwa
Organize duplicated implementations
shohei-yamagiwa committed 8 days ago
f795a7c
Browse files »
@shohei-yamagiwa
Replace all 'toImplementation(String[])' with new 'IExpressionVisitor#accept(Expression, String[])'
shohei-yamagiwa committed 8 days ago
97f9a5a
Browse files »
@shohei-yamagiwa
Change the declaration style of an array
shohei-yamagiwa committed 8 days ago
c1508d8
Browse files »
@shohei-yamagiwa
Add JavaImplementationVisitor to separate the source code generation logic in the model class from its data structures
shohei-yamagiwa committed 8 days ago
9463a93
Browse files »
@shohei-yamagiwa
Format files
shohei-yamagiwa committed 8 days ago
1199710
Browse files »
@shohei-yamagiwa
Add IExpressionVisitor and implement its method in subclasses
shohei-yamagiwa committed 8 days ago